May 14th
1787 ~ Delegates began gathering in Philadelphia for a convention to draw up the U.S. Constitution.
1925 ~ Death of H. Rider Haggard, Author.
1948 ~ The independent state of Israel was proclaimed.
1955 ~ The USSR and seven other communist bloc countries signed a mutual defense treaty called the Warsaw Pact.
1969 ~ Birthday of Cate Blanchett, Australian actress (Galadriel).
1973 ~ Skylab 1, the first American space station, was launched.
1978 ~ Death of Robert Menzies, twelfth Prime Minister of Australia.
1987 ~ Death of Rita Hayworth, American actress.
1998 ~ Death of Frank Sinatra, Singer & Actor.
2004 ~ Piers Morgan was fired as editor of the Daily Mirror for publishing photographs of alleged abuse of Iraqi prisoners by British soldiers that were shown to be fake.

May 17th
1749 ~ Birthday of Edward Jenner, inventor of vaccination.
1838 ~ Death of Charles Maurice de Talleyrand, French diplomat.
1935 ~ Death of Paul Dukas, French composer.
1936 ~ Birthday of Dennis Hopper, Actor & Director.
1943 ~ The RAF carried out the Dambusters raid.
1954 ~ The U.S. Supreme Court issued their decision in Brown v. Board of Education.
1974 ~ Thirty-three people were killed by terrorist bombings in Ireland.
1992 ~ Death of Lawrence Welk, American musician.
1996 ~ President Bill Clinton signed a measure requiring neighborhood notification when sex offenders move in - Megan's Law.
2004 ~ Same-sex marriage became legal in Massachusetts.

May 18th
1872 ~ Birthday of Bertrand Russell, Logician & Philosopher, awarded The Nobel Prize in Literature 1950.
1910 ~ The Earth passed through the tail of Halley’s Comet.
1911 ~ Death of Gustav Mahler, Austrian Composer.
1919 ~ Birthday of Dame Margot Fonteyn, Ballet dancer.
1937 ~ Birthday of Brooks Robinson, Baseball Hall of Famer.
1944 ~ Monte Cassino fell to the Allies.
1974 ~ India became the sixth nuclear nation by successfully detonated its first nuclear weapon.
1975 ~ Death of Leroy Anderson, American Composer.
1980 ~ Mount St. Helens in Washington state exploded, leaving 57 people dead or missing.
1993 ~ In a penetrating comment on the European notion of democracy, the second attempt to ratify the Maastricht Treaty, which could not come into effect unless ratified by all members of the European Union, was placed before the Danes. When the result of the referendum was announced, the outcome and frustrations about the referendum being held only a year after the Danes had rejected the previous treaty led to riots in the Nřrrebro area of Copenhagen, during which the police fired into a crowd. 11 people were subsequently treated for gunshot wounds.

May 19th
1536 ~ Anne Boleyn, the second wife of Henry VIII of England was beheaded for adultery.
1795 ~ Birthday of Johns Hopkins, Philanthropist.
1890 ~ Birthday of Ho Chi Minh, Vietnamese leader.
1921 ~ The U.S. Congress passed the Emergency Quota Act, which established national quotas for immigrants.
1925 ~ Birthday of Pol Pot, Khmer Rouge leader.
1935 ~ Death of T. E. Lawrence, English soldier ("Lawrence of Arabia").
1965 ~ Tui Malila, the longest living animal known, died in Tonga at the age of either 188 or 192.

May 20th
1873 ~ Levi Strauss and Jacob Davis received a U.S. patent for blue jeans with copper rivets.
1883 ~ The eruption of Krakatoa began, leading ultimately to the volcano's destruction three months later.
1896 ~ Death of Clara Schumann, German Pianist and Composer.
1901 ~ Birthday of Max Euwe, Dutch world chess champion.
1927 ~ Charles Lindbergh took off from Long Island, New York, on the first solo nonstop flight across the Atlantic Ocean, arriving in Paris the next day.
1940 ~ The first prisoners arrive at the Auschwitz concentration camp.
1961 ~ U.S. marshals were sent to restore order in Montgomery, Alabama.
1989 ~ Death of Gilda Radner, American comedian and actress.
2000 ~ Death of Jean Pierre Rampal, French flutist.
2002 ~ Death of Stephen Jay Gould, American paleontologist.

May 22nd
1813 ~ Birthday of Richard Wagner, Composer.
1840 ~ Transporting British convicts to the New South Wales colony was abolished.
1856 ~ In one of the more impressive expressions of American democracy, Congressman Preston Brooks of South Carolina beat Senator Charles Sumner with a cane in the hall of the U.S. Senate because of a speech Sumner had made which attacked Southerners who sympathized with the pro-slavery violence in Kansas.
1859 ~ Birthday of Sir Arthur Conan Doyle, Physician & Writer.
1885 ~ Death of Victor Hugo, French author.
1907 ~ Birthday of Sir Laurence Olivier, Actor & Director.
1907 ~ Birthday of Hergé, comic book creator.
1947 ~ The Truman Doctrine was enacted.
1969 ~ The lunar module of Apollo 10 separated from the command module and flew to within nine miles of the moon's surface in a dress rehearsal for the first lunar landing.
1972 ~ Ceylon became the republic of Sri Lanka, adopted a new constitution, and joined the British Commonwealth.

May 23rd
1430 ~ Joan of Arc was captured by the Burgundians, who sold her to the English.
1701 ~ Captain William Kidd was hanged in London after being convicted of piracy and murder.
1848 ~ Birthday of Otto Lilienthal, aviation pioneer.
1873 ~ Canada's North West Mounted Police force was established.
1906 ~ Death of Henrik Ibsen, Norwegian writer.
1908 ~ Birthday of John Bardeen, the only man to have been awarded the Nobel prize in Physics twice; 1956 & 1972.
1934 ~ Death of Bonnie and Clyde, Outlaws.
1951 ~ The Tibetan government is forced to sign the Seventeen Point Agreement for the Peaceful Liberation of Tibet with the People's Republic of China.
1951 ~ Birthday of Anatoly Karpov, Russian chess grandmaster and former World Champion.
1962 ~ Raoul Salan, the leader of the Secret Army Organisation (OAS) was sentenced to life imprisonment.

May 24th
1819 ~ Birthday of Queen Victoria.
1844 ~ The first telegram was sent by Samuel Morse, from Baltimore, Maryland to Washington, D.C., saying "What hath God wrought?".
1883 ~ The Brooklyn Bridge was opened.
1941 ~ The German battleship Bismarck sank the battlecruiser HMS Hood in the North Atlantic, killing all but three crewmen.
1941 ~ Birthday of Bob Dylan, Singer and Songwriter.
1969 ~ Death of Willy Ley, rocket scientist.
1976 ~ BOAC and Air France opened trans-Atlantic Concorde service to Washington.
1995 ~ Death of Harold Wilson, Prime Minister of the United Kingdom.
2001 ~ 23 people were killed and hundreds injured at a wedding party in Jerusalem when the floor collapsed.
2001 ~ Democrats gained control of the U.S. Senate for when Sen. Jeffords of Vermont declared himself an independent.
